Box Spring Disposal Questions
What types of box springs are accepted for disposal? Standard metal or wooden box springs are typically accepted; specialty or upholstered models may require special handling.
Is there a limit to how many box springs can be disposed of at once? Disposal services generally accommodate multiple items, but it's best to check if there are any restrictions on quantity or size.
Do box spring disposal services include removal from inside the home? Most services handle removal from accessible locations, but arrangements may be needed for difficult-to-reach areas.
What should be done before disposing of a box spring? It’s recommended to remove bedding and any other materials, and ensure the item is free of personal belongings prior to disposal.
